I can't speak for everybody but, I have had my app. walked in since 2005 by
three different sources at different times, a 777 captain (with over 30 years in), an Air Canada instructor and finally by a pilot that was still on probation.
Despite seeing many posts by different people on the forum with about the same experience as I had, I have to tell you that it was only in April of 2007 that I got the email did the interview and am now at AC. I can't think of any better range of endorsements, so why did it take so long? I don't know about your situation but I must say that the influence of my different supporters doesn't seem to have had much/any effect. I think that it is just a question of time. So lay off the "Daddy got me my job" because I don't think that AC really gives a #!@#!@#.
